Abstract

Let Tₙ denote the set of all labelled spanning trees of Kₙ. A family F Tₙ is t-intersecting if for all A, B F the trees A and B share at least t edges. In this paper, we determine for n>n₀ the size of the largest t-intersecting family F Tₙ for all meaningful values of t (t n-1). This result is a rare instance when a complete t-intersection theorem for a given type of structures is known.
